Our organization receives calls on a daily basis from consumers shopping around for the lowest price for laser hair reduction. Rarely are we asked about whether or not we have lasers that are considered safe for medium to darker skin types.

Although consumers may not understand the technology, they need to be proactive in asking the right questions. Because laser hair reduction generates the most business, the technology has advanced quite a bit in the last few years. Gone are the days when only light skinned patients with dark, coarse hair received good outcomes.

In our practice, we've found that the long pulsed Nd: YAG laser is superior for darker skin types. Not only does this type of laser have consistent, good outcomes - it is extremely safe for dark skin. Our facility currently has five long pulsed Nd: YAG lasers, and we are pleased with the consistent results are patients achieve.

Besides having the most appropriate laser for your skin type - you must know who will be performing the treatments. Do not hesitate to ask what their credentials are (is it an RN, laser tech, esthetician, MD?) AND, what is their training and experience with your skin type. The abbreviations behind one's name does not equate to experience. Know what your state regulations are, ask good questions, and don't put cost above safety.
